    Core Network Support Engineer – Fixed Data

    Reporting to the Manager – Core Network Data Support, the responsibility of the Core Network Engineer – Fixed Data shall include but is not limited operation, maintenance, optimization, automation, transformation, implementation & support of Evolved Packet Core for Fixed Data (FixedLTE, 5G Fixed Wireless Access, FTTx Core).

    Key Responsibilities

    Key accountabilities and decision ownership:

    • Responsible for implementation, Operation and Maintenance of EPC network elements: SGSN/MME, GGSN/PGW/SGW, PCRF, DNS, EPSN.
    •  Integration of 4G, 5G RAN to the core network.
    • Integration to Billing, routers, switches, CGNAT, Firewalls, DNS, etc
    • Implementation and support of new products: FixedLTE, Fixed 5G Wireless, QOS, Rating groups, LTEoMPLS, etc
    • Integration of FTTx Core to EPC: Broadband Network Gateways (BNG) for FTTx, Enterprise networks.
    • Perform tracing and complex logs analysis for Packet Core Nodes.
    • Exceptional troubleshooting skill is required to solve the customer issues without escalating to the vendor.
    • Proactive maintenance and monitoring of key network and system KPIs
    • Configuration management
    • Perform BCP exercises and documentation as per BCP calendar.
    • Develop predictive analysis to avert system faults/incidents.
    • Fault/incident resolution within SLA
    • Assists with the design process and assists in guidance with regards to practices, procedures, and techniques.
    • Works with Business Agile teams and technology teams to determine if Core Network infrastructure and applications fit specification and technical requirements.
    •  Tests and evaluates systems, subsystems, and components.
    • Acts as a technical contact and liaison for outside vendors and/or customers.
    • Troubleshoots and resolves complex Core network issues affecting customer experience.
    • Designs and configures Core Network System.

    QUALIFICATIONS

    Must have technical / professional qualifications:

    • Bachelor’s Degree or Equivalent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, Information Systems or  related certification
    • Generally requires 3-5 years related experience

    Desired Qualifications:

    • Hands-on knowledge in the following areas:
      • LTE and 5G NSA callflows
      • FTTH/GPON access/core
      • Intermediate to advanced Routing and switching of Cisco and/or Huawei IP networks.
    • Practical (testing, troubleshooting) knowledge of the mentioned above technologies
    • Knowledge and experience in using various test, packet capture and measurement equipment.
    • Linux administration and networking.
    • Added advantage: Knowledge of NetDevOps delivery pipeline for automation of network operations and management: Python, Ansible, Git, etc
